Howlite (also kwown as Magnesite) was named after Henry How, who discovered it in 1868 in Nova Scotia. Howlite is a borate or soft, porous mineral and caution should be taken around water. It is mainly found in Canada and California but some deposits have also been found in Turkey, Germany, Mexico and Russia. It is  thought to be a calming stone and a non-traditional stone for those born under the zodiacal sign of Gemini. Additionally, howlite is believed to eliminate anger and absorb negative energy. 
In it's mined state, it is usually milky white, grey, yellow and often dispersed with dark-brown or black veins.  Because it is so porous, it is a favorite stone to dye since it will maintain it's dark veins and create fantastic looking stones.
